Tampa welcomes travelers from the hustle and bustle of New York City with warm weather, sandy beaches and fun experiences for the whole family. Whether you're a theme park fan in town to visit Busch Gardens or a day spent cruising among the dolphins is more your style, this city on Florida's Gulf Coast offers everything from sporting events to fine dining to attract everyone from couples and families to larger groups. Nonstop flights from New York City to Tampa are available to whisk you from the daily grind to a fun adventure.
Flights from New York City to Tampa take approximately three hours, give or take 15 minutes, depending upon which carrier and departure airport you choose.
You can find flights from New York City to Tampa on a multitude of carriers, including jetBlue, United, American, Spirit and Silver Airways. Find your favorite carrier for your flight on Cheapflights.
Flights between New York City and Tampa run fairly frequently with service beginning as early as 6 a.m. at some airports. These flights run throughout the day, with later flights landing at approximately midnight.
The city of New York City is served by three major airports. John F. Kennedy International Airport and LaGuardia Airport are located at opposite ends of Queens, while Newark Liberty International Airport is located in nearby New Jersey, close to Manhattan. Tampa, Florida, is home to two major airports: Tampa International Airport and St. Pete-Clearwater International Airport.
The cheapest direct route between New York and Tampa takes off from Newark Liberty and lands at Tampa International Airport. Coming in at a close second is the route from John F. Kennedy International to Tampa International Airport. Choose your route by figuring costs of travel to your departure airport and then looking at rental car costs or shuttle transportation time and cost at your arrival airport. While both New York City and Tampa are large cities, the "Big Apple" endures all four seasons while Tampa features a more moderate temperature all year long, although summers can be humid. Plan a visit in late winter, spring or fall, and escape the sometimes harsh weather of New York City for a bit of fun in the sun. Spend time in downtown Tampa Bay, and you'll find art museums and theaters to rival New York City, and the city boasts a river walk that has you strolling by quaint shops, historical buildings and even the Florida Aquarium. Thrill seekers will love a visit to Busch Gardens Tampa, and the magic of Disney is just a short hour and a half drive north in Orlando if you're up for a road trip.
